苹果CMS优化数据库性能,需采取以下策略:利用索引加速数据检索,确保表间关系和约束的正确设置;定期分析和优化数据库结构,避免过长的字段名和无效的数据类型;合理配置缓存机制,如使用内存缓存减少对数据库的频繁访问;监控数据库性能并及时调整配置,确保系统运行在最佳状态,通过这些措施,可显著提升苹果系统下数据库的性能和管理效率。
在当今数字化时代,苹果CMS(Content Management System,内容管理系统)已成为许多网站和应用不可或缺的后台工具,随着网站访问量的不断增长,数据库性能问题逐渐凸显,本文将深入探讨苹果CMS如何优化数据库性能,帮助网站管理员提升用户体验和网站运营效率。
数据库设计优化
-
规范化数据库结构:通过规范化的设计减少数据冗余,确保数据的唯一性和准确性,从而提高查询效率。
-
合理划分数据表:根据业务需求合理划分数据表,如将用户信息、文章内容等不同类型的数据存储在不同的表中,便于后续的查询和维护。
索引优化
-
创建合适的索引:针对经常用于查询条件的字段创建索引,如标题、日期等,以提高查询速度。
-
复合索引的使用:对于多个字段组合形成的查询条件,可以考虑创建复合索引,以进一步提升查询效率。
查询优化
-
避免全表扫描:尽量使用索引进行查询,避免不必要的全表扫描,从而提高查询速度。
-
优化SQL语句:编写简洁明了的SQL语句,避免使用复杂子查询和嵌套查询,减少查询时间和资源消耗。
-
缓存查询结果:对于不经常变动的数据,可以考虑使用缓存技术,将查询结果缓存起来,减少对数据库的访问次数。
数据库连接优化
-
合理配置数据库连接池:根据网站的并发量和访问量合理配置数据库连接池的大小,确保在高并发情况下数据库连接的可用性。
-
使用连接池管理工具:采用专业的数据库连接池管理工具,如数据库连接池监视器等,实时监控数据库连接的使用情况并进行调整。
定期维护与检查
-
定期清理无用数据:定期删除或归档不再需要的数据,减少数据库的负担。
-
备份数据库:定期备份数据库,防止因意外情况导致数据丢失。
-
性能监控与调优:使用专业的数据库性能监控工具,实时监控数据库的性能指标,并根据实际情况进行调优。
通过数据库设计优化、索引优化、查询优化、数据库连接优化以及定期维护与检查等措施,可以显著提升苹果CMS的数据库性能,希望本文能对广大苹果CMS使用者提供有益的参考和帮助。